Windows not finding the printer
I have successfully connected my Brother printer to the internet through my T-Mobile box, but when I try to connect to it on any of my computers (two laptops and a desktop), none of them can find a printer. I dumbed the network down to 2.4 GHz, WPA/WPA/2, TKIP & AES and repeatedly rebooted everything without success. All are showing up as connected devices on the T-Mobile Internet app, but Windows is not finding the printer. I have tried connecting directly using the printer’s IP address, but that doesn’t work either. I talked with T-Mobile Home Internet Support, but after running through things the only suggestions were (1) to delete the printer’s drivers, etc., from the computer and go back through the printer installation (which I did, with no change) or to add a Mesh and try connecting through that. Any suggestion on getting Windows to see the printer that is on the network? I am about ready to jump back to ATT.
